How does it work?

Unlike other attributes, these 'derived attributes' cannot be assigned any value directly. A formula is associated with them based on which they derive the attribute value for every user, in real time. Continuing with the example of 'age' - if an attribute 'date of birth' is already available it is easy to derive 'age' based on it & the current date. As you would see in the screenshots below, a formula (with specific syntax) is associated with such attributes.

Employee Garrison app currently supports following two derived attributes.

  • Stay with us - Gives you the duration of the employee's association with your company (using current date & joining date)
  • Age -  Derives a value that equals to the employee's age (using current date & date of birth)

Stay with us

Stay with us attribute is derived from joining date of employment details section. Stay with us attribute provides a value that is equal to the real-time tenure of the employee. If you look at the image below, the type of stay with us attribute is stated as 'derived' which is selected by default. You cannot make any changes in this attribute type and its formula. Let us see what formula is used to calculate the stay with our value.

Formula 

Image Removed

DAYSDIFF([CurrentDate], att(9))

This syntax is specific to Employee Garrison.

How to find the attribute key?

Click on edit attribute from where you want to derive some value. On edit pop-up, you will see a number at the right top corner, that is the identifier used in the formula.

Age 

The same formula is applicable to the age attribute, which is again a derived attribute from date of birth in personal details section in the system.

Formula

Image Removed

DAYSDIFF([CurrentDate], att(305))

This syntax is specific to Employee Garrison.

Final output on a user profile 

As per formula: 

DAYSDIFF([CurrentDate], att(305))

29years,0 months, and 22 days = ([26 Apr 2018] - (04 Apr 1989))
